Proto-West Germanic

Etymology

From *golþ (gold) + *massing (brass).

Noun

*golþamassing m

  1. orichalcum, yellow copper ore

Alternative reconstructions

  • *golþamassjing

Descendants

  • Old English: goldmæstling, goldmestling, goldmæslinc (altered by -ling, intrusive -t-)
    • Middle English: goldmessing
  • Old Saxon: goldmessing
  • Old High German: goldmessing, goldmessinc
